We have constructed S. cerevisiae strains carrying genomic deletions of six ORFs from the left arm of chromosome II ( YBL018c , YBL019w , YBL024w , YBL042c , YBL043w and YBL046w ) in both FY1679 and W303 backgrounds. We have found that YBL018c is an essential gene in yeast, whereas the other five genes are non‐essential. We have developed plasmids carrying deletion cassettes that can be used to delete any of the six genes in S. cerevisiae by transforming to G418‐resistance, as well as centromeric plasmids containing the cognate genes.
